Project:
View Issue Details[ Jump to Notes ] | [ Issue History ] [ Print ] | |||||||
ID | ||||||||
0022278 | ||||||||
Type | Category | Severity | Reproducibility | Date Submitted | Last Update | |||
defect | [Openbravo ERP] A. Platform | major | always | 2012-11-13 11:06 | 2013-02-11 13:10 | |||
Reporter | plujan | View Status | public | |||||
Assigned To | AugustoMauch | |||||||
Priority | urgent | Resolution | duplicate | Fixed in Version | ||||
Status | closed | Fix in branch | Fixed in SCM revision | |||||
Projection | none | ETA | none | Target Version | ||||
OS | Any | Database | Any | Java version | ||||
OS Version | Database version | Ant version | ||||||
Product Version | main | SCM revision | ||||||
Merge Request Status | ||||||||
Review Assigned To | ||||||||
OBNetwork customer | No | |||||||
Web browser | Apple Safari, Google Chrome, Mozilla Firefox | |||||||
Modules | Core | |||||||
Support ticket | ||||||||
Regression level | Production - Confirmed Stable | |||||||
Regression date | ||||||||
Regression introduced in release | ||||||||
Regression introduced by commit | ||||||||
Triggers an Emergency Pack | No | |||||||
Summary | 0022278: Null Pointer Exception when opening the Create Lines From window in Goods Receipt | |||||||
Description | Using latest mp17 candidate (3.0.18519) I've found that the Create Lines From window is not opened and a NPE message is shown instead. | |||||||
Steps To Reproduce | 1. Login as Openbravo user 2. Open Goods Receipt window 3. Create a new header in grid mode 4. Click the Create Lines From button. NPE message is shown (see attach) Log output is this: java.lang.NullPointerException at org.openbravo.erpCommon.ad_actionButton.CreateFrom.printPageShipment(CreateFrom.java:698) at org.openbravo.erpCommon.ad_actionButton.CreateFrom.callPrintPage(CreateFrom.java:277) at org.openbravo.erpCommon.ad_actionButton.CreateFrom.doPost(CreateFrom.java:154) at org.openbravo.base.HttpBaseServlet.doGet(HttpBaseServlet.java:287) at javax.servlet.http.HttpServlet.service(HttpServlet.java:617) at org.openbravo.base.HttpBaseServlet.serviceInitialized(HttpBaseServlet.java:225) at org.openbravo.base.secureApp.HttpSecureAppServlet.service(HttpSecureAppServlet.java:435) at javax.servlet.http.HttpServlet.service(HttpServlet.java:717) at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:290) at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206) at org.openbravo.utils.SessionExpirationFilter.doFilter(SessionExpirationFilter.java:66) at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:235) at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206) at org.openbravo.utils.CharsetFilter.doFilter(CharsetFilter.java:35) at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:235) at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206) at org.openbravo.client.kernel.KernelFilter$1.doAction(KernelFilter.java:62) at org.openbravo.dal.core.ThreadHandler.run(ThreadHandler.java:46) at org.openbravo.client.kernel.KernelFilter.doFilter(KernelFilter.java:71) at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:235) at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206) at org.openbravo.dal.core.DalRequestFilter$1.doAction(DalRequestFilter.java:81) at org.openbravo.dal.core.ThreadHandler.run(ThreadHandler.java:46) at org.openbravo.dal.core.DalRequestFilter.doFilter(DalRequestFilter.java:103) at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:235) at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206) at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:233) at org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:191) at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:127) at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:102) at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:109) at org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:298) at org.apache.coyote.ajp.AjpAprProcessor.process(AjpAprProcessor.java:429) at org.apache.coyote.ajp.AjpAprProtocol$AjpConnectionHandler.process(AjpAprProtocol.java:384) at org.apache.tomcat.util.net.AprEndpoint$Worker.run(AprEndpoint.java:1665) | |||||||
Tags | No tags attached. | |||||||
Attached Files | ![]() | |||||||
![]() |
||||||||
|
![]() |
|
(0054196) dmitry_mezentsev (viewer) 2012-11-13 12:01 |
It is happening the same in the Goods Shipment window. It only happens in the Grid view, it works in the Form view. |
(0054197) dmitry_mezentsev (viewer) 2012-11-13 12:05 |
With another error (see below) but it happens the same in MP13.2 so seems like very old issue. "Error With your current role you don't have write permission." |
(0054198) dmiguelez (viewer) 2012-11-13 12:06 |
By clicking again a second time, it is working. By saving before clicking on the button it works. Seems a problem with autosave in grid view. |
(0054199) plujan (viewer) 2012-11-13 12:33 |
Updated Category and Regression Level. It is a problem that happens not only with Create Lines From window but with autosave. If saving first, the issue will not happen. And using autosave it will happen in most of the windows when clicking a process button (the orange ones) |
(0054655) alostale (viewer) 2012-11-29 14:30 |
Not a regression |
(0056330) AugustoMauch (administrator) 2013-02-11 13:10 |
This issue gets fixed applying the patch attached to the issue 22625 |
![]() |
|||
Date Modified | Username | Field | Change |
2012-11-13 11:06 | plujan | New Issue | |
2012-11-13 11:06 | plujan | Assigned To | => dmiguelez |
2012-11-13 11:06 | plujan | File Added: NPE in Create Lines From.png | |
2012-11-13 11:06 | plujan | Web browser | => Apple Safari, Google Chrome, Mozilla Firefox |
2012-11-13 11:06 | plujan | Modules | => Core |
2012-11-13 11:06 | plujan | OBNetwork customer | => No |
2012-11-13 11:06 | plujan | Web browser | Apple Safari, Google Chrome, Mozilla Firefox => Apple Safari, Google Chrome, Mozilla Firefox |
2012-11-13 11:06 | plujan | Regression level | => Packaging and release |
2012-11-13 12:01 | dmitry_mezentsev | Note Added: 0054196 | |
2012-11-13 12:05 | dmitry_mezentsev | Note Added: 0054197 | |
2012-11-13 12:06 | dmiguelez | Note Added: 0054198 | |
2012-11-13 12:33 | plujan | Web browser | Apple Safari, Google Chrome, Mozilla Firefox => Apple Safari, Google Chrome, Mozilla Firefox |
2012-11-13 12:33 | plujan | Regression level | Packaging and release => Production - Confirmed Stable |
2012-11-13 12:33 | plujan | Note Added: 0054199 | |
2012-11-13 12:33 | plujan | Assigned To | dmiguelez => alostale |
2012-11-13 12:33 | plujan | Category | 03. Procurement management => A. Platform |
2012-11-29 14:30 | alostale | Web browser | Apple Safari, Google Chrome, Mozilla Firefox => Apple Safari, Google Chrome, Mozilla Firefox |
2012-11-29 14:30 | alostale | Priority | immediate => urgent |
2012-11-29 14:30 | alostale | Note Added: 0054655 | |
2012-11-29 14:30 | alostale | Assigned To | alostale => AugustoMauch |
2012-12-10 21:29 | dmitry_mezentsev | Web browser | Apple Safari, Google Chrome, Mozilla Firefox => Apple Safari, Google Chrome, Mozilla Firefox |
2012-12-10 21:29 | dmitry_mezentsev | Triggers an Emergency Pack | => No |
2012-12-10 21:29 | dmitry_mezentsev | Severity | critical => major |
2013-02-11 13:10 | AugustoMauch | Relationship added | has duplicate 0022625 |
2013-02-11 13:10 | AugustoMauch | Note Added: 0056330 | |
2013-02-11 13:10 | AugustoMauch | Status | new => closed |
2013-02-11 13:10 | AugustoMauch | Resolution | open => duplicate |
2013-02-11 13:36 | AugustoMauch | Relationship deleted | has duplicate 0022625 |
2013-02-11 13:36 | AugustoMauch | Relationship added | duplicate of 0022625 |
Copyright © 2000 - 2009 MantisBT Group |